Description:
I wanted to print something that helps during these turbulent times and which ideally prevents harm to people.
As we touch our faces quite often with our hands, it is at the moment very important to wash your hands regularly. However, you cannot wash your hands each time you open a door and also the door handle cannot be cleaned after each person.
So I came up with the idea of a printed part which allows to open the door without using your hand. It turns out that many people had a similar idea.

How to use:
1) print the part (recommended settings below)
2) put some rubber bands or something else made out of rubber around the door handle
3) use 2 or 3 zipties through the holes in the part to fix the part to the door handle (see photos)
4) use your arm to open the door instead of your hand
General note:
Of course, I cannot guarantee, that this part will prevent you from getting any illness. However, as most people are regularly touching their faces with their hands and not their arms, I think it is a sensefull tool in conjunction with regularly washing your hands and sticking to social distancing.
